The Hackathons and Mentoring Programme are part of the EU Defence Innovation Scheme (EUDIS). They give a unique opportunity to get acquainted with the European defence sector, connect with like-minded individuals and organisations, and use your knowledge and skills to solve current defence challenges together as a team!

The EUDIS hackathon 2024 will take place in six hybrid locations over Europe simultaneously. The challenges, timeline and EU-level prizes will stay the same, and the six hackathons will only have some location specific differences!

On this page you can read more about EUDIS Belgium! If you want to hear more about this hackathon, please contact the organisers at: eudis.belgium@soprasteria.com
Be sure to also check out EUDIS Hackathon 2024 Belgium on Instagram!

WHO SHOULD JOIN?

We invite all students, young professionals, military academies alumni, young military personnel, maker culture members, startups and entrepreneurs, mid-cap company leaders, and innovators within large enterprises.

All participants should be of +18 years of age, and be both a citizen and a resident of an EU27 country or Norway. You should apply in teams with 2-5 members. You can only attend one of the EUDIS 2024 hackathons, since all hackathons take place simultaneously.

The theme of the 1st edition is “Digital in Defence”. Below you can read more about the three sub-challenges.

STARGATE - Sustainable Aviation

The Stargate project obtained funding under the special Green Deal call of Horizon 2020, more in particular under the topic of “green ports and airports”.  It received the maximum score of the evaluators and was selected out of more than 40 projects. Stargate’s purpose is to prove that sustainable aviation is possible and happening. It focuses on the further decarbonization of the aviation industry, the improvement of local environmental quality and the stimulation of the modal split. Together with a consortium of 21 European partners with a diverse and rich expertise (airports, community partners, knowledge institutions, consultants, local governments, …), Brussels Airports takes the lead as lighthouse airport to develop and implement innovative solutions. Results that prove successful can be deployed at the fellow airports (Toulouse, Budapest, Athens). Over the course of the coming five years, the consortium will exchange knowledge to investigate and realize more than 30 concrete projects.
